Gog Posted November 26, 2011 Share Posted November 26, 2011 After 60+ hours of play, here's what I think. The good: Highly addictive game. The more quests I pick up, the more I want to play to complete them. The story is good. Lasts 100+ hours, I'm guessing. It's like a MMO that you play alone. The bad: Graphics are no better than Fallout 3, although commercials (and some reviews) would make you think they were not only some of the best, but something new. The voice-acting is horrendous. I have to play the game with the sound off, otherwise my eyes start to hurt from rolling them so much. Maybe the most monotonous game I've ever played. 90% of the missions are "go to this place & clean out the dungeon" missions. Every dungeon, except the dwarf ones, look exactly alike. Monsters are either soldiers, giant spiders, ghosts or Draugr (zombies. YAWN!) Glitches. Lots of glitches. I think Bethesda is Greek for 'glitches'. The AI in the game is some of the worst I've seen as well. The way your Companions jump in front of you as you spew fire at the enemy, or jump right in front of your already swinging weapon is just ridiculous. I don't know how many times I've had to reload because I have killed them. Enemy AI is not much better. I've stole a carrot once, off a table. No one was around. Suddenly, a guard runs up to arrest me. Regardless of these negatives, I'm having lots of fun with it. However, those saying that Skyrim is Game of the Year just sound silly. This game will eventually get to me, as it's not really exciting & after this playthrough, I doubt I will have any desire to play it again. I give it a 7.5 out of 10. The Human Torch Posted November 27, 2011 Author Share Posted November 27, 2011 I've not had that one yet, thankfully. But there is a new neat thing in the game that sorta relates; if you do successfully steal or murder there are times when "someone" might have seen "something"... basically like an investigation happened and someone goes, "yeah, I think I remember seeing [player character] around there". In those cases your victim or relations of will send either Hired Thugs or Dark Brotherhood to hunt you. You do not get an official bounty though, it's all above the law retribution. Gog Posted November 28, 2011 Share Posted November 28, 2011 I found the game was starting to run real choppy, especially in the cities, when I hit about 7K. I tried a few things that seemed to work. Yesterday, I spent 5 hours selling all my stuff. Exploiting a glitch in the game where you can talk to a certain guy over & over, I raised my speech to 100, which also raised my level by 6 levels. I upgraded the speech abilities & invested in the 4 main stores in Whiterun. There is also a glitch which spawns an unlimited amount of a certain book, that you can sell for 32-35 gold each. After selling all the extra stuff I wasn't going to use, I found the game was running a lot smoother. I also used the "wait for a month" trick & that seemed to smooth it out a little more as well. This trick supposedly gets rid of bodies & items that are laying around.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

The Human Torch Posted November 30, 2011 Author Share Posted November 30, 2011 You can cure Vampirism, I think you need to read the book Immortal Blood for hints to how to start that path. There is a copy of Immortal Blood in the Bard's College in Solitude. Edit: Apparently you start the Cure quest by asking a bartender about rumors. http://www.uesp.net/wiki/Skyrim:Vampirism#Cure_for_Vampirism Afterthought: You should check to see if curing vampirism causes you to be immune to becoming a werewolf... as being a werewolf is important to a certain faction.
